Generally, timely filing limits are marked from the date of service for claims (or date of discharge for inpatient claims) and date of claim determination for an appeal. They are simply deadlines for filing claims or appeals to an insurance provider. How do I find out the time limit for a claim? What is timely filing for BCBS?īCBSTX asks that providers file all claims as soon as possible but no later than 365 days from the date of service or date of discharge for in-patient stays or according to the language in the subscriber/provider contract. Different payers will have different timely filing limits some payers allow 90 days for a claim to be filed, while others will allow as much as a year. In medical billing, a timely filing limit is the timeframe within which a claim must be submitted to a payer.
